CPR/AED
for the Professional Rescuer
Course fee includes the
required textbook, pocket mask, use of equipment and certification in "CPR/AED
for the Professional Rescuer" (valid for 2 years in most cases). Instruction includes one-
and two-rescuer CPR for Adults, Infant & Child CPR, bag-valve-mask and
pocket mask resuscitation skills, use of body substance isolation
precautions to prevent disease transmission, and use of an AED (Automated
External Defibrillator) for a victim of sudden cardiac arrest.
Course Fee: $65.00 (Cost w/out Pocket Mask $57.00; Cost w/out Book and
Pocket Mask $49.00)

Babysitter's Training
This babysitters training course will provide individuals, ages 11-15,
with the information and skills necessary to provide safe and responsible
care for children in the absence of parents or adult guardians. This
training will help participants develop skills in leadership and
professionalism; basic care; safety and safe play; first aid and how to
evaluate and respond to emergencies.
The cost includes a newly revised (r.02)
handbook, pin, use of equipment, certification in "Babysitter's Training"
and a regular Infant/Child CPR card. Prerequisite: Students must be 11 years old by the last day of
the class.
Course Fee: $60.00

Scrubby
Bear
The Scrubby Bear presentation teaches children ages 4 to 7 years
old how germs are spread, how to prevent the spread of disease and to
properly wash their hands. The presentation is taught in approximately 20
minutes.
Basic Aid Training (BAT)
Basic Aid Training (BAT) is a six-hour course. BAT introduces 8 - 10
year-olds (grades 3 - 5) to the emergency action steps, Check-Call-Care, as
well as to basic first aid procedures. An activity book with puzzles and
games teaches children how to prevent injuries and what to do in an
emergency.
First Aid for
Children Today (FACT)
First Aid for Children Today (FACT) is a 10 - 14 hour course. The FACT
Critter Clan leads kids, aged 5 - 8 (grades K - 3), through health promotion
and injury prevention activities. Its environmental theme teaches safety in
a non-threatening way. Topics include (1) hygiene and health habits, (2)
first aid, (3) personal safety and (4) injury prevention.

Pet First Aid
Learn
the skills necessary to provide emergency care to help keep a dog or cat
alive, reduce pain and minimize consequences until veterinary help is
received. Learn how and when to call for assistance for an injured animal.
Identify breathing and cardiac emergencies and how to care for them. Deal
with bleeding and sudden illnesses and learn how to move an injured pet.
The cost is $35.00 for either course and includes a Dog or Cat First Aid book.

Sports Safety Training (Includes Adult CPR)
The purpose of this course is to provide individuals with the knowledge
and skills necessary to provide a safe environment for athletes while they
are participating in sports, and in an emergency, to help sustain life and
minimize the consequences of injury or sudden illness until help arrives.
The units of the class are Sports Injury Prevention and First Aid, Adult
CPR/AED and Child CPR/AED. This is an all-day course typically taught on
Saturdays.
The class is available to groups of coaches on request.
The cost of this course will be $65.00 per person.

Family Caregiving Workshop
Three one-hour sessions on (1) General Caregiving
Skills, (2)Home Safety, and (3) Caring for the Caregiver. You will learn to
measure vital signs such as pulse, respirations and temperature; how to
provide a safe environment for themselves and their loved ones; and to care
for your own health while caring for another.
The cost is $30,including all materials.

Emergency Response Course
This course will train individuals with the knowledge and skills necessary
to work as a responder in an emergency to help sustain life, reduce pain and
minimize the consequences of injury or sudden illness until more advanced
medical help can arrive. Successful candidates will receive certification
in "Emergency Response" (valid for 3 years) and "CPR/AED for
the Professional Rescuer" (valid for 1 year). The fee of $120.00 covers
textbook, workbook, pocket mask, use of equipment and certification. This
course runs approximately 56 hours in length and participants must attend
all sessions. If you are interested in the Emergency Response course,
please contact the chapter office for more information.

Wilderness
First Aid Basics
This two-day, 16-hour course is for hikers, hunters, backpackers, scouts...
anyone who works, lives or plays in remote areas. This class covers
injury/illness assessment, urgent first aid techniques, care of major
injuries, bites, stings, outdoor illnesses and evacuation techniques. It
does not include in-depth CPR. A minimum age of 15 is recommended for
participants due to the serious nature of the course and its scenarios.
There are no prerequisites for this course.
Cost: $75.00.
This covers all texts, course materials, certification, Wilderness First Aid
Basics patch plus meals and refreshments for both days.
